In this workshop, you as a student will enjoy the exhilarating process of
painting the model from life on the first day and on the second day, painting
from a photo, as if painting from life. You will experience creating real life
at the end of your brush when you jump into painting the form directly, without
drawing.
Emphasis for this workshop is "simple": simple ideas that create powerful
paintings. Concepts, abstract design, value, edges, colour - all the
fundamentals will be explored. Artist demo during the workshop as well as
individual guidance throughout. Workshop includes the Friday evening portrait
demonstration, followed by this fun, but challenging workshop. Beginners
through to the experienced painters welcome.
